Output e24c63b5a3db609554bb8bac4ceb54f763088e9d0f952564a4698ee761bf52b6:1

value
6892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b4eb945a55cb8002012e071b84ae1bb15a9356d OP_EQUAL
address
35e1HcUC4DdyeTThbNRVD8sirKAPqZXqGy
transaction
e24c63b5a3db609554bb8bac4ceb54f763088e9d0f952564a4698ee761bf52b6